Structural integrity is a primary technical consideration. The supply data reveals a divergence in material composition, with listings specifying both "Plastic" and "Metal" as primary construction materials. Metal frames generally offer superior load-bearing capacity and durability for high-traffic hospital environments, whereas plastic components may be utilized for specific non-structural elements or in lighter-duty applications. The "Manual Bed" and "Electric Bed" classifications suggest that the two-function mechanism can be either manually operated via cranks or levers or powered by an electric motor system. Buyers must verify the specific actuation method for their intended use case, as the maintenance requirements and operational speed differ significantly between these two modes.

For facilities with limited space, the "Folded" capability is a decisive factor. The ability to fold the bed allows for efficient storage and easier maneuvering in crowded corridors. The "Two-function" mechanism typically allows for adjustments in the head and foot sections, facilitating patient positioning for feeding, sleeping, or medical procedures. Buyers should ensure that the specific two-function model meets the clinical needs of their patient demographic, particularly regarding the range of motion and the stability of the bed in the adjusted positions.

Long-Term Procurement and Lifecycle Management

Sourcing a two-function foldable hospital bed is not a one-time transaction but the beginning of a long-term relationship with the supplier. The "1 Year" warranty is a starting point, but buyers should consider the total cost of ownership, including maintenance, spare parts availability, and potential upgrades. The "Manual Bed" and "Electric Bed" distinction is crucial here; electric beds may require specialized technicians for repairs, whereas manual beds are generally easier to maintain in-house.

The "Small" scale attribute suggests that the supply chain may be more agile, but it also implies that the supplier might not have the capacity for rapid scaling if the buyer's needs expand. Buyers should assess the supplier's ability to handle future orders and provide consistent quality over time.
